It won't answer your question directly but scanning remote services is sooo easy to do from a windows machine.
On the other hand running Win32::Services from a Solaris box seems like something difficult to achieve.
Therefore, I think the easiest way would be to write a Perl script running on a Windows server and then send the relevant results to the Unix server.
